Thursday night’s Sweet Sixteen matchup between 4-seed Florida State and the 1-seed Gonzaga Bulldogs will feature a couple of firsts for the Seminoles in the 2019 NCAA Tournament. After wins over the 13-seed Vermont Catamounts and the 12-seed Murray State Racers, the ’Noles will face their first single-digit seed of the tourney. And they’ll do so as an underdog for the first time in this year’s big dance.
The Bulldogs have opened as a 7-point favorite over FSU in a rematch of a West region Sweet Sixteen game that the Seminoles won impressively in last year’s tournament. Of course, the Zags were favored in that game as well. But both of these teams are better than they were last year. Gonzaga and Florida State were seeded 4th and 9th last year, respectively.
